About CortexaPro AI
CortexaPro AI is an enterprise-grade agentic orchestration platform that layers on top of the systems you already run — CRM, HRMS, ERP, ITSM, Finance, and Data Lake APIs — rather than forcing a replacement. You build custom agents with structured inputs, memory, and decision layers in Cortexa Studio, connect data sources and triggers, then chain agents into execution pipelines that handle document generation, approvals, and reporting. Every request passes through security guardrails, and you get role-based access control, department-level isolation, audit logs, and real-time execution tracking. CortexaPro is multi-region, with compliance handling for the US, UK, India, and MENA. Two side products round it out: the Cortexa Launchpad marketplace, with 10 flagship public agents and 48+ agents in total, where a single run typically costs 60–85 credits and outputs range from a screenshot-to-React-component converter to an OpenAPI-to-backend scaffolder; and the consumer-facing Cortexa companion, which does multi-model chat across GPT, Claude, and Gemini, AI image generation, and 30+ life tools spanning cooking, studying, fitness, travel, design, games, and planning. Pricing is credit-based rather than subscription-locked, with a free tier and a Pro plan whose custom price is quoted on request. It's aimed at IT operations, business analysts, and compliance-heavy departments inside organizations with fragmented tech stacks — it's not built for a small team that just wants a casual chatbot. Cortexa Academy adds AI exam prep across 58+ IT certifications and 30+ global exams.
Behind the Verdict
CortexaPro's positioning is honest about what it is: an orchestration layer that sits on top of your stack instead of a rip-and-replace platform. That matters if you've already spent years and budgets on CRM, ERP, and ITSM systems and don't want to throw them out. The architecture diagram on their homepage is blunt about the problem — six islands, six consoles, zero shared context — and the pitch is that CortexaPro provides the shared context layer. Where it's strong: agent construction with structured inputs, memory, and decision layers; deployment with a visible separation of build/connect/deploy stages; role-based access with department isolation; audit logs and real-time execution tracking; and genuinely multi-region compliance (US, UK, India, MENA). The credit-based metering is also a practical choice — you pay per run rather than per seat, which suits teams with bursty automation workloads. The Cortexa Launchpad is unusually concrete for this category. Each public agent takes a defined input and returns a defined deliverable: a contract or SLA becomes architecture scope docs (Synapse Architect), an OpenAPI YAML becomes a backend scaffold (CodeCraft · API → Backend), a UI screenshot becomes a React component (CodeCraft · Screenshot → Component), and legacy COBOL/VB/jQuery gets lifted to a modern stack (CodeCraft · Legacy → Modern). Runs are priced per run at 60–85 credits, which is transparent for a marketplace in this space. The companion consumer app (multi-model chat across GPT, Claude, Gemini, image generation, 30+ life tools, and Cortexa Academy's 58+ IT cert and 30+ global exam prep tracks) is a nice-to-have but not the reason to buy the enterprise product. Where it's weaker: full enterprise features require a paid plan quoted on request, which means you can't self-serve into the tier most buyers actually need. The platform appears web-only. Integration depth varies by CRM/ERP vendor, so you'll need to validate your specific stack during onboarding. And the brand still has limited third-party coverage — you're betting on a newer vendor, so it's worth getting a paid pilot before a multi-year commitment.

Real-world workflow fit
Concrete scenarios for the personas CortexaPro AI actually fits — and what changes day-one when you adopt it.
Build a procurement agent in Cortexa Studio that queries the ERP for open purchase orders, routes anything over threshold to the approval queue, and logs every action with the requester's role and timestamp.
Outcome: Purchase-order approvals complete without manual handoffs, and every decision is captured in the audit log for compliance review.
Chain a Finance API agent, a Data Lake agent, and a document generation agent into a weekly pipeline that pulls numbers, writes the executive summary, and emails it with department-level access restrictions.
Outcome: The weekly executive report ships automatically with role-scoped distribution, replacing hours of manual data stitching.
Hand the CodeCraft · Legacy → Modern agent COBOL or jQuery source, receive lifted modern-stack output, then export it directly into the repo or pass it into a Cortexa Studio workflow for review.
Outcome: Legacy modules are scaffolded into a modern stack in minutes instead of weeks, with the output landing where the team already works.

Limitations
- The free tier offers limited credits, and the Pro tier — which unlocks the custom agent builder, system integration agents, pipelines, RBAC with audit logs, and multi-region compliance — is quoted on request rather than self-serve.
- The platform appears web-only with no mobile or desktop apps.
- Integration depth varies by CRM/ERP vendor, so validating your specific stack requires a technical onboarding step.
- Broader enterprise features and pricing details are gated behind a contact form, which makes apples-to-apples cost comparison against named competitors harder before a demo.

Setup time & first value
How long it actually takes to get something useful out of CortexaPro AI — broken out by persona, not the marketing-page minute.
Individuals on the free tier reach first value in minutes — sign in, pick a model, and chat. Business analysts building their first agent in Cortexa Studio typically need a day to get structured inputs and one integration wired up.
